St. Bernard Sheriff’s Office attends first annual Recover Rally

Organizers of the 1st annual St. Bernard Parish National Recovery Month Rally held Sept. 23 in the St. Bernard Parish government complex council chambers in Chalmette are, from left: Jack Lafitte, James Terluin, Mike Sherwood, Robert Feezkus, and Tia Serigne.
Members of the St. Bernard Sheriff’s Office who were in attendance included Capt. Adrian Chalona, corrections division; Stanley Simeon, coordinator of the department’s Addiction Resource Program; and Pastor Aaron Johnson, Sheriff’s Office chaplain.
National Recovery Month (Recovery Month) is a national observance held every September to educate Americans that substance use treatment and mental health services can enable those with a mental and/or substance use disorder to live a healthy and rewarding life.
